RiverNorth Capital and Income Fund (RSF) closed at $14.59, reflecting a minimal decline of 0.17% in the latest session. The stock continues to trade between its established support at $13.86 and resistance at $15.32, with the current level approaching the upper end of that range. Price action suggests a period of consolidation as investors weigh the fund's income-oriented strategy against broader market conditions.
